ROCKAWAY, N.J., Sept. 29,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- electroCore, Inc. (Nasdaq: ECOR), a commercial-stage bioelectronic medicine and wellness company, today announced that gammaCore™ Sapphire (nVNS) has been included in a long-term reimbursement policy launched by the National Institute for Health and Disability Insurance (RIZIV / INAMI) in Belgium.
Effective October 1, 2025, the policy provides coverage for gammaCore Sapphire to treat patients with cluster headaches. This coverage is based on strong clinical evidence supporting the therapy’s efficacy and cost-effectiveness and ensures broader access for Belgian patients.
“The reimbursement of gammaCore by RIZIV / INAMI is a remarkable step forward for patients suffering from cluster headaches in Belgium,” said Prof. Paemeleire, leading the Headache Clinic of the Neurology Department at Ghent University Hospital. “This decision reflects the growing recognition of the clinical and economic benefits of non-invasive vagus nerve stimulation. As a healthcare provider, I am pleased that this reimbursement will now allow more patients to access a therapy that can significantly improve their daily lives while contributing to a more sustainable healthcare system.”
This achievement was made possible through the leadership and commitment of Silvert Medical, electroCore’s distribution partner in Belgium. Silvert Medical leveraged their local expertise and strong provider relationships, playing a key role in securing reimbursement. Silvert Medical remains a vital partner in supporting the rollout of gammaCore in Belgium and is committed to extending access to gammaCore in neighboring countries.
“Securing long-term reimbursement in Belgium, in the center of Europe, is a major milestone in expanding access to our non-invasive therapies,” said Tanja Martin, Senior Director of Strategic Product Lifecycle at electroCore. “We’re proud to partner with Silvert Medical to bring gammaCore to patients in Belgium.”

About electroCore, Inc.

electroCore, Inc. is a commercial stage bioelectronic technology company whose mission is to improve health and quality of life through innovative non-invasive bioelectronic technologies. The Company’s two leading prescription products, gammaCore non-invasive vagus nerve stimulation (nVNS) and Quell neurostimulator, treat chronic pain syndromes through non-invasive neuromodulation technology. Additionally, the company commercializes its handheld, and personal use Truvaga and TAC-STIM nVNS products utilizing bioelectronic technologies to promote general wellness and human performance.For more information, visitwww.electrocore.com.
